AI Technical Summary

Technical Problem

Existing garment processing equipment requires complete loading and transportation during exhibitions, which is costly and prevents users from intuitively understanding the equipment's functions and advantages.

Method used

Design a garment processing demonstration device that uses a box to simulate the appearance of a finished product, and has a built-in display device and circuit board assembly to automatically play media files to demonstrate the device's functions, principles, and advantages.

Benefits of technology

Reduced transportation costs, easier handling, and visitors can intuitively understand equipment information, reducing the workload of sales staff.

Abstract

The embodiment of the present application provides a kind of clothes processing demonstration equipment, including box, display device and circuit board assembly, display device is set to box, display device has display area;Circuit board assembly is connected with display device signal, for making display area display preset one or more media files, wherein at least one media file is used to display the function, principle, advantage, working parameter of clothes processing equipment at least one of them.The embodiment of the present application, it can be convenient to show in, for example, exhibition, sales shop etc.Local, and because it does not need to be loaded into barrel body assembly and the like component, the weight of relatively light, easy to carry, low cost.In addition, it can be actively, automatically display the relevant information of clothes processing equipment by display area, it is convenient for visitor to intuitively understand the relevant information of clothes processing equipment, both convenient to show to visitor, also can reduce the workload of sales personnel.

Technical Field

[0001] This application relates to the field of model technology, and in particular to a clothing processing demonstration device. Background Technology

[0002] In related technologies, when garment processing equipment needs to be displayed in exhibition halls or exhibition centers, it needs to be fully assembled and transported to the exhibition site, resulting in high manufacturing and transportation costs. During the display, users cannot intuitively understand the functions and advantages of the garment processing equipment. Utility Model Content

[0003] In view of this, the present application aims to provide a garment processing demonstration device to at least solve one of the above-mentioned technical problems. For example, while demonstrating the appearance of the garment processing device, it is beneficial to reduce transportation and costs.

[0004] This application provides a clothing processing demonstration device, including:

[0005] Box;

[0006] A display device is disposed in the housing, and the display device has a display area;

[0007] A circuit board assembly, signal-connected to the display device, is used to display one or more preset media files in the display area, wherein at least one of the media files is used to display at least one of the functions, principles, advantages, and operating parameters of the clothing processing equipment.

[0008] In some implementations, the media files include at least one of presentation videos, presentation images, and presentation text; and / or, the number of media files is multiple, and the display area displays multiple media files sequentially or randomly.

[0009] In some implementations, the one or more media files include at least one clothing processing media file corresponding to the clothing processing mode; and / or, the one or more media files include a screensaver media file.

[0010] In some embodiments, the enclosure includes a front panel, and the display area of ​​the display device is located on the front surface of the front panel.

[0011] In some implementations, the front panel has an opening through which the display area is displayed.

[0012] In some embodiments, the projection of the opening does not exceed the projection of the display area in the plane of the display device.

[0013] In some embodiments, the garment handling demonstration device includes a door that is rotatably connected to the housing for opening or closing the opening; or, the opening is exposed to the external environment of the garment handling demonstration device.

[0014] In some embodiments, the garment handling demonstration device includes a cover that covers the opening, and the portion covering the opening is at least partially translucent.

[0015] In some implementations, the covering portion is a flexible membrane or a rigid plate.

[0016] In some implementations, the display device includes a screen that is circular or rectangular.

[0017] The garment processing demonstration device of this application has a casing that is identical or similar in appearance to the outer shell of the finished garment processing device, making it convenient for display in places such as exhibitions and retail stores. Furthermore, since it does not require the inclusion of components such as the cylindrical body, the garment processing demonstration device is relatively lightweight, easy to transport, and cost-effective. In addition, relevant information about the garment processing device can be actively and automatically displayed on the display area, allowing visitors to intuitively understand the device's information. This facilitates demonstrations to visitors and reduces the workload of sales staff. Attached Figure Description

[0026] This application provides a clothing processing demonstration device, which refers to a clothing processing device for imitation products. Please refer to... Figure 1 and Figure 2 The clothing processing demonstration equipment includes a cabinet 10 and a display device 30.

[0027] The housing 10 is designed to mimic the shape of the outer shell of a garment processing device. In other words, from an external perspective, the outline of the housing 10 is the same as or similar to the outer shell of a finished garment processing device.

[0028] In this embodiment of the application, the garment processing equipment refers to the garment processing equipment for finished products, which is equipment that can perform functions such as garment washing and care.

[0029] It should be noted that the material of the casing 10 is not limited; it can be plastic or metal.

[0030] In some embodiments, the housing 10 can utilize the outer shell of an existing garment processing device. This eliminates the need for a separate mold for manufacturing the housing 10.

[0031] The display device 30 has a display area 30a, which refers to the part of the display device 30 used for display. For example, the display device 30 includes a screen, and the area on the screen that can be imaged is the display area 30a.

[0032] The clothing processing demonstration device also includes a circuit board assembly, which is signal-connected to the display device to enable the display area 30a to display one or more preset media files.

[0033] In this application, signal connection refers to the existence of signal interaction. The two components can interact directly or indirectly through other components. For example, in some embodiments, signal connection is achieved through circuitry. In other embodiments, signal connection can be achieved through wireless communication technologies, such as Bluetooth, WiFi (Wireless Fidelity), NFC (Near Field Communication), Wireless Local Area Network (WLAN), Infrared Communication (IRC), etc., and no limitation is imposed here.

[0034] In this embodiment, the circuit board assembly can enable the display area 30a to play media files without receiving operation instructions from the operator.

[0035] These media files can be pre-stored files embedded in the circuit board assembly, or they can be downloaded from the cloud when the circuit board assembly is connected to the network.

[0036] Among them, at least one media file is used to display at least one of the functions, principles, advantages, and operating parameters of the garment processing equipment (finished garment processing equipment).

[0043] The display format of media files is not limited. For example, in some implementations, media files include at least one of presentation videos, presentation images, and presentation text.

[0044] Specifically, in embodiments where the media file includes a demonstration video, the demonstration video can display the principles, functions, duration, advantages, etc. of the clothing processing procedure, providing a better visual experience and a more intuitive viewing experience.

[0045] In embodiments where the media file includes presentation images, the presentation images can be switched and played one by one.

[0046] In embodiments where the media file includes presentation text, parameters, duration, etc., may be displayed.

[0047] Understandably, the display device 30 may use at least one of the following: demonstration video, demonstration image, or demonstration text, to display at least one of the functions, principles, advantages, and operating parameters of the garment processing equipment.

[0048] For example, the aforementioned one or more media files include at least one clothing processing media file corresponding to a clothing processing mode. The aforementioned clothing processing media file refers to visual information about clothing processing modes (such as washing, drying, and spin-drying) displayed according to certain rules. Such visual information can be used to demonstrate to viewers the functions of clothing processing equipment, the principles of clothing processing, and the advantages of clothing processing equipment.

[0049] Each garment processing mode has a corresponding garment processing media file, and the same garment processing mode can correspond to one or more garment processing media files.

[0050] Different clothing processing modes require different clothing processing media files.

[0051] Garment processing mode refers to the main washing and care program of the garment processing equipment. For example, garment processing modes include blue oxygen color protection wash, wool wash, steam care, 6D airflow drying, etc.

[0052] In one embodiment, the display device 30 uses a display screen, such as an LCD (liquid crystal display) or an OLED (organic light-emitting diode).

[0053] In some embodiments, one or more of the aforementioned media files include screen saver media files. For example, when the device is powered on or when an external power source is connected, the circuit board assembly may cause the display area 30a to display the screen saver media files.

[0054] "Powering on" refers to the entire garment processing demonstration device being powered on (not simply being connected to an external power source). For example, the garment processing demonstration device includes a power switch, which can be a button or a knob. The garment processing demonstration device is connected to an external power source (such as AC mains power) by plugging it into a socket. Powering on is achieved by operating the power switch. In other words, when the power switch is operated, the entire device powers on, and the display area 30a begins displaying the media saver file.

[0055] The clothing processing demonstration device being connected to an external power source means that it obtains power from an external power source. In other words, in some embodiments, when plugged into a socket, the display device 30 displays the media saver file regardless of whether the power switch is operated.

[0056] Understandably, before the garment processing demonstration device is powered on or before the device is connected to an external power source, the display area 30a is in a black screen state. After the device is powered on or connected to an external power source, the display area 30a displays the display saver media file, which can also be used to remind the user that the garment processing demonstration device is currently connected to an external power source.

[0057] In some embodiments, there are multiple media files, which are displayed sequentially or randomly in the display area. Sequential display can involve cyclically displaying a portion of the multiple media files or cyclically displaying all the media files.

[0058] In some implementations, the garment handling demonstration device also includes a speaker, which is signal-connected to a circuit board assembly. The circuit board assembly is used to control the speaker to play audio adapted to the current media file.

[0059] In this embodiment, visitors can hear corresponding audio while viewing the content displayed on the display device 30, further enhancing their experience.

[0060] The audio can be stored in the circuit board assembly or in the cloud.

[0061] It should be noted that the position of the display device 30 relative to the housing 10 is not limited. For example, it can be inside the housing 10 or outside the housing 10, as long as it can be seen by visitors.

[0062] Specifically, in some embodiments, the housing 10 includes a front panel 12, a rear panel, two side panels 11, and a top panel 14. The housing 10 may or may not have a bottom panel.

[0063] Two side panels 11 are arranged at intervals along the left-right direction of the housing 10. The front, back, and rear panels are arranged at intervals along the front-rear direction. The top panel 14 connects the top of the front panel 12, the top of the rear panel, and the top of the two side panels 11.

[0064] In some embodiments, the display area 30a of the display device 30 is located on the front surface of the front panel 12. For example, the display device 30 can be a flexible screen that is attached to the front surface of the front panel 12 for aesthetic purposes. In this embodiment, the front panel 12 does not need to have an opening for the display area 30a.

[0065] In some embodiments, the front panel 12 has an opening 10a through which the display area 30a is displayed. In this embodiment, the display device 30 may be located in the opening 10a or inside the housing 10.

[0066] The shape of the opening 10a is not limited, but the edge of the opening 10a is at least partially curved. For example, the opening 10a can be circular, semi-circular, or other shapes.

[0067] The opening 10a can be a blind hole (i.e., the opening 10a does not penetrate the front panel 12) or a through hole (i.e., the opening 10a penetrates the front panel 12).

[0068] In some embodiments, the opening 10a may simulate the shape of the garment loading / unloading opening of a garment processing device for finished products.

[0069] In some embodiments, please refer to Figure 2 The garment handling demonstration device includes a door 20, which is rotatably connected to the housing 10 to open or close the opening 10a.

[0070] In other embodiments, since actual washing and care of the clothes is not required, please refer to [link to relevant documentation]. Figure 1 The opening 10a is exposed to the external environment of the garment processing demonstration device. In other words, the opening 10a is always exposed to the external environment, and there are no structural components to block the outside of the opening 10a, i.e., there is no door to block it (i.e., the garment processing demonstration device does not have a door at the opening 10a for opening or closing). As a result, the garment processing demonstration device has no door in appearance, which makes the structure of the garment processing demonstration device simpler, lighter, and easier to transport, and can further reduce costs.

[0071] In other embodiments, the garment handling demonstration device includes a cover that covers the opening 10a, and the portion covering the opening 10a is at least partially translucent. The cover prevents users or other structures from directly touching the display area 30a, thus protecting the display area 30a. Furthermore, the cover allows light transmission in the area to be displayed, enabling viewers to view the content displayed in the display area 30a through the cover. It should be noted that the cover is not a door; that is, the garment handling demonstration device does not have a door at the opening 10a for opening or closing. Of course, when the cover covers the edge of the opening 10a, it also prevents the edge of the opening 10a from scratching people.

[0072] The part of the cover located outside the display area 30a can be light-transmitting; of course, it can also be light-shielded by means of coating, screen printing, etc.

[0073] For example, the cover is in the form of a plate or a film, and is stacked on the front surface of the front panel 12. The outline shape of the cover can be made into any desired shape.

[0074] In some embodiments, the covering portion can be a flexible membrane or a rigid plate. A flexible membrane refers to a membrane that can be bent, with a thickness of 0.1 mm to 1 mm, or other thicknesses. The flexible membrane can be PVC (polyvinyl chloride) film, PE (polyethylene) film, TPU (thermoplastic polyurethane) film, EVA (ethylene-vinyl acetate copolymer) film, etc.

[0075] Rigid panels refer to rigid structures, such as glass panels and rigid plastic panels.

[0076] In some embodiments, the projection of the opening 10a onto the plane containing the display area 30a of the display device 30 does not exceed the projection of the display area 30a. In this embodiment, the display area 30a can completely overlap with the opening 10a, that is, the outline of the display area 30a coincides with the outline of the opening 10a. Of course, the display area 30a and the opening 10a can also partially overlap, with the other part not overlapping, that is, in the projection onto the plane containing the display area 30a, part of the projection of the display area 30a is within the range of the opening 10a, and part of the projection is outside the range of the opening 10a.

[0077] In this embodiment, the opening 10a can be fully displayed, making full use of the size of the opening 10a, resulting in a large display area and better display effect.

[0078] In some embodiments, the display device 30 includes a screen, which is circular or rectangular. Circular or rectangular screens are standard shapes, and their manufacturing processes are relatively mature and simple, which can effectively reduce costs.
